Financial Policy
Fantasy Dance School is committed to providing clear, consistent, and transparent billing practices. Please review the following financial policies before enrolling.
Registration Fees
An annual, non-refundable registration fee is required each school year.
-
$95 per student
-
$150 per family
Registration is not complete until all required fees are paid and a valid credit card is on file.
Tuition
Tuition is calculated based on the total instructional weeks of the school year and is divided into 11 equal monthly payments (September through July) for consistent monthly billing.
-
Tuition is due on the 1st of each month.
-
August tuition is prorated because the school year begins in mid-August.
-
Tuition remains the same each month regardless of the number of classes scheduled.
-
Multi-class discounts are automatically applied.
